Masuyama eyepieces, rigorously designed and manufactured in Japan with the highest quality standards, have always been a benchmark for discerning visual amateur astronomer.
Features Masuyama Ortho Plössl (MOP) eyepiece 35 mm 53°
Focal length: 35 mm.
53° apparent field of view (AFOV).
Eye relief: 23.5 mm.
Modified Plössl optical design with 5 lenses in 3 groups.
FMC - Fully Multi-Coated optical treatment.
High refractive index lenses for excellent containment of chromatic aberration.
Blackened lens edge.
Retractable rubber lens hood.
Standard 2"/50.8 mm barrel with threads for in-cell filters.
Size: 53 mm OD x 104 mm L.
Weight: 300 g.
Japanese manufacture with the highest quality standards (Ohi Kohki Co., Ltd.).

High-quality optics for exceptional image quality The new eyepieces feature an optical system with 7 elements in 5 groups that surpasses the conventional XW series to deliver sharp star images right to the edge of the field of view.
PENTAX original multi-coating for outstanding light transmission All lens surfaces that come into contact with the air are treated with the original multi-coating, while all laminated surfaces are treated with the innovative partial coating to achieve light transmission of more than 90 per cent (an astonishing 96 per cent at 550nm) across the visible lightspectrum.
Advanced light-shielding technology for improved image contrast Thanks to PENTAX's advanced computer simulation technology, the XW series features a lightshielding diaphragm in the most effective position to dramatically reduce internal reflections and provide a brighter, higher contrast image.
Weatherproof construction for all-weather viewing The XW Series features a JIS Class 4* weatherproof construction that allows use even in drizzle or nighttime dew.

The SV230 super zoom aspheric eyepiece is featured with clickstop click and Parfocal design, 55°-75° panoramic wide angle provides you with the ultimate observation comfort. It also supports astigmatic corrector connection. Long eye relief of 17-19mm for comfortable viewing position, even for eyeglass wearers.
Takahashi TOE eyepieces have been designed for high magnification observation of the Moon and the planets with optimal comfort. On the TOA-130 telescope, 4 mm, 3.3 mm and 2.5 mm eyepieces are used to achieve magnifications of 250x, 300x and 400x respectively.
